Subject:
URL mistake made by Google
Category: Sports and Recreation > Outdoors Asked by: adarina-ga List Price: $5.00 |
Posted:
28 Aug 2002 19:15 PDT
Expires: 27 Sep 2002 19:15 PDT Question ID: 59708 |
Google has listed my URL with an error. They list "sailing.sanfranciscoapartment.us/sailSFbay.html" and that leads to an error message because it should be: "www.sanfranciscoapartment.us/sailSFbay" I wrote their webmaster about without results. |

Subject:
Re: URL mistake made by Google
Answered By: webadept-ga on 29 Aug 2002 11:14 PDT |
As posted by secret901-ga below, Google doesn't manually update their indexes. The best thing to do at this point, so that you don't loose traffic to your site, and have a lot of people think you are off the web, is to add the file and place a redirect tag in the header of that file. I've made one for you that you can download from http://www.lucidmatrix.com/uploads/redirect.txt Right click on the link and choose "save target as" to get it to your computer. Change the name of this file to sailSFbay.html and place it in your main area, where google is sending people. This will redirect the browser to the proper page and get you fixed up until Google re-indexes your site. Thanks, webadept-ga |
